For Young Women's I wanted to give the girls some healthy alternatives to always drinking sodas (pop in Utah). I searched the web for low fat smoothies and I fell in love with the
"Banana Mango Smoothie".
2 frozen, ripe bananas (the frozen bananas make it cold so refrigerate after if you don't have any frozen bananas or add some ice)
1 mango, peeled and sliced
10 ounces orange juice
1 cup low fat or fat free vanilla or mandarin orange yogurt (I used vanilla)
Cut bananas into chunks. In a blender, combine all ingredients and blend until smooth. If the smoothie is too thick, thin with a little more orange juice or ice. Pour into 4 glasses.
per serving: 150 calories, Fat 0.8g, carbohydrate 32g, fiber 1.9g
3 Weight Watcher Points
I froze the extra and it is so good to eat frozen. Great for a 106 degree day.
